Brandt's cormorants - they nest on the jetty that extends from the end of the Coast Guard dock. They are long-necked diving birds, very tough and aggressive, that build their nests each year from sea grasses. With them are resting California sea lions, which migrate north-south along the west coast of N. America. Monterey Bay gets almost entirely males in the winter, then yearlings start coming around in May. Adult females tend to stay more to the south, below Big Sur, where there's warmer water for their young pups.
